Susanna Emerson 1711–1753 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 19 Jun 1711

Birth Location: Haverhill, Essex, Massachusetts, United States

Death Date: 25 Apr 1753

Death Location: Hampstead, Rockingham, New Hampshire, United States

Father: Benjamin Emerson

Mother: Sarah Silver

Spouse(s): Caleb Heath

Children(s): Priscilla Heath

In 1711, Susanna Emerson entered the world in Haverhill, Essex, Massachusetts, United States, born to Benjamin Emerson And Sarah Silver. Susanna Emerson married Caleb Heath, and had children including Priscilla Heath. Susanna Emerson passed away in 1753 in Hampstead, Rockingham, New Hampshire, United States.
